Verify Professional Licensing

Never skip confirm that your chosen professional is a registered outdoor planner. In Washington, this license ensures they’ve met rigorous examination standards and can legally sign off on structural and grading plans. Unlike a general landscape designer, a licensed pro has the authority to submit plans for permits—critical for complex projects involving site grading.

Typical Costs in Western Washington

Determining the standard cost for a licensed landscape architect in the Puget Sound region depends on project complexity. Most outdoor professionals charge from $150 to $350 per hour or offer lump-sum pricing for design-build projects. For private yards, expect to invest anywhere from $5,000 to $25,000+ for complete landscape planning.

  • Initial consultations typically cost between $100–$300 or are complimentary with full design services
  • Conceptual fees average one-tenth to one-fifth of total project construction costs
  • Value-driven options exist through phased implementation or scaled-back features

Runoff Handling Integration

In rainy Western Washington, effective drainage planning is critical for protecting your property and local ecosystems. A skilled landscape architect may incorporate rain gardens to naturally filter and slow runoff. These features not only address water damage but also comply with municipal regulations, enhancing your property’s resilience during heavy downpours.

  • Rain garden installations can reduce runoff by up to 90% in residential zones
  • Slope design directs water away from foundations and into designated absorption areas
  • Proper drainage solutions prevent pooling and landscape degradation

What’s the Difference Between a Landscape Designer and a Licensed Architect?

While both a garden planner and a certified professional may create stunning garden plans, only a regulated design pro can legally sign off on complex projects involving stormwater management in King County. This includes work that affects zoning compliance, which often requires official permits and engineering coordination.

Landscape architects undergo rigorous education and testing, allowing them to handle large-scale residential. In contrast, garden stylists often focus on plant selection without structural or regulatory oversight.
